• The Mechanical Engineering course provides a comprehensive engineering education covering design, engineering mathematics, and its application, the core concepts of mechanics, thermodynamics, structural dynamics, materials and the behavior of fluids.
  • As students progress through the course, they will also cover the principles of control systems, advanced materials and manufacturing processes including Additive Layer Manufacturing (ALM)/ 3D-printing of plastics and metals. Students will use computer-aided modelling, design and analysis software to validate product designs.
  • Analysing the performance of materials and structures under in-service conditions through the use of finite element analysis and computational fluid dynamics is one highlight of the course. Accordingly, they will have the ability to use industry level FEA packages to analyze the performance of various engineering components.
